I haven't got three children yet but just thinking hypothetically.
If you have three children and go on holiday what do you do? Two separate rooms in a hotel? Always use villas? Or something else?

We have three children and always have a one or two bedroom apartment. It's really a non issue. We go to Greek islands and Cyprus usually and have no probs finding accommodation.

Varied year on year.
When they were little, it would generally be a caravan, so sort out when got there and they'd often move around on different nights.
Then we used to go to cottages, and again, sometimes all in together, occasionally we'd get somewhere with 3 rooms.
By the time we started going abroad, the dc generally shared and dh and I had a different room.
You then get to the stage where one or another of them doesn't come for one reason or another.
